Sony Pictures Home Entertainment has unveiled full specs for the June 12 Blu-ray release of 'Ghost Rider,' which will hit next-gen in a new, unrated extended cut.
The film, which grossed over $100 million at the domestic box office and is already shaping up to be one of Blu-ray's most anticipated new releases this summer, will be presented in a newly-extended version with footage not seen in theaters when it bows the disc day-and-date with the standard-def version on June 12, as first reported late last month.
Other extras include two audio commentaries (the first with director Mark Steven Johnson and effects supervisor Kevin Mack, and the second with producer Gary Foster), the "Spirit of Vengeance: The Making of 'Ghost Rider'" documentary and the Theatrical Trailer.
Tech specs include a BD-50 dual-layer disc, a 1080p/AVC MPEG-4 transfer and an uncompressed PCM 5.1 surround track (48kHz/16-bit/4.6mpbs).
Sony has set a $38.96 list price for the release.
